Rodless Cylinder REA Sine Accelerating & Decelarating Magnetically Coupled-Basic Type

The REA, Sine Rodless Cylinder – Magnetically Coupled accelerates slowly at
beginning stroke and decelerates at end stroke designed for working with
delicate materials such as silicone wafers, magnetic disks or LCD
substrates yet optimizing throughput with speeds of up to 300 mm/sec. The
REA features specially designed U-shaped cushion rings at the cylinder end
caps to prevent hard stops. The corresponding sides of the piston head have
special cushion packing to faciliate smooth acceleration at the start of
stroke. Please note the REA must be used with an external guide to support
the load.

– Bore sizes: 25, 32, 40, 50, 63 mm
– Stroke lengths: 200, 250, 300, 350, 400, 450, 500, 600, 700, 800, 900,
1000 mm
– Maximum stroke lengths: 4000 mm (25 & 32 bore), 5000 mm (40 bore),
6000 mm (50 & 63 bore)
– Minimum operating pressure: 0.18 MPa (26 psi)
– Speed: 50 ~ 300 mm/sec.
